There is usually an EastEnders star in the Strictly Come Dancing line-up, and Danny-Boy Hatchard would fit the bill.

The actor first attracted Strictly buzz when he appeared in Children In Need, dancing with co-star Shona McGarty to Dirty Dancing's (I've Had) The Time Of My Life. He also popped up in Let's Sing and Dance for Comic Relief as Elton John.

Having left his role as Lee Carter in the BBC soap earlier this year, his other commitments are to two stage shows. Hatchard will be in Oliver Twist (July-August) and Eyes Closed Ears Covered, which begins the day after the Strictly launch show is filmed and runs for the whole of September. Sure, he'd have to juggle the two in those initial weeks of dance training – but after that his schedule would presumably be wide open.


Sheila Hancock

Strictly Come Dancing bosses sometimes use previous Christmas specials as hunting ground for future contestants. Veteran actress Sheila Hancock won the festive version of the show in 2012 and she's still going strong, so could she be the perfect candidate to follow on from Lesley Joseph?

At 84, Hancock would be the oldest contestant Strictly has ever had – by a whole ten years.
